Infrared Thermography Fundamentals

  • Key Concepts, History, Science of Infrared Thermography
  • Professional Thermographer Core Practices
  • Electromagnetic Spectrum, Thermogram Basics
  • Thermal Diagnostics, Temperature Measurements
  • Infrared Thermography Applications, Thermogram Palettes
  • Spatial Resolution, Instantaneous Field Of View (IFOV)
  • Live Practical Demonstrations

 

Thermal Camera Operations & Optimal Usage

  • Identifying Ideal Thermal Camera Choices
  • Camera Specifications, Spanning, Auto vs Manual Settings
  • Background vs Target Temperature Test
  • Thermodynamics & Blackbody Radiation Laws
  • Problem Area Case Study Analysis
  • Emissivity, Colour Tape Test

 

Real-world Hands-on Practice

  • Indoor Simulation Test Kit Experiments
  • Outdoor On-Site Field Inspections
  • Building Facades, Electrical Panels, HVAC Systems
  • Interpreting Thermal Data
  • Qualitative vs Quantitative Thermography

 

Report Generation, Collaboration, Graduation

  • Essential Infrared Softwares
  • Report Creation Framework & Templates
  • Expert-led Q&A Discussion
  • Network with Experienced Thermographers
  • Assessment & Graduation
